Reg Park
Reg Park was a strongman, bodybuilder and an actor from England, born in 1928. He was very active as a kid and he specialized in football, until he met David Cohen in 1944. David was a muscular guy who trained at his friend’s house, so Reg wanted to see what’s …
Abbye Pudgy Stockton
Abbye “Pudgy” Stockton was a strongwoman born in 1917 in Santa Monica, California. Despite the fact that she weighed around 115 pounds at a height of 5’2″, “Pudgy” got her nickname as a child and it stuck until the end of her days. Abbye and her husband Les Stockton, whom …
Steve Reeves
Steve Reeves was born in 1926 and he is best known as a bodybuilder and actor. At his peak, Steve had an incredibly symmetrical physique as he stood at 6’1″, weighed 216 pounds with 18½” arms, 52″ chest, and a 29″ waist. Steve started training at the age of 16 …
John Grimek
John Grimek was born in 1910 in New Jersey, where he started training with his older brother George, who was already well developed and bigger than John. However, his brother wasn’t as interested in competitions as John was and in 1934 John took a heavy weight contest in New Jersey, …

John Grimek Hand-to-Hand Balance
Here is John Grimek holding Glenn Marlin in a low hand-to-hand balance. This shot made the cover of the short lived magazine Acro-Chat.
